Some users may encounter omg.exe as a harmless joke file. The GitHub repository named "ERROR408.EXE-AND-OMG.EXE" provides a binary file that is likely intended for pranks or as a joke. However, this repository has been flagged with a note that "releases are broken" and the file was uploaded in March 2022, so it may not function as intended on modern systems.
Malicious executables can install keyloggers on your device. These programs record your keystrokes, allowing hackers to steal your passwords, credit card details, and personal identification info. 3. System Instability

Ensure the digital signature of the .exe file is from a known and trusted publisher before running it.
Before opening any executable file, upload it to . This free online service scans the file with over 60 different antivirus engines and provides a detailed report on any detected threats. This is a crucial step for verifying the safety of any download.
